7. Prince Hans-Adam II of Liechtenstein – Net Worth: $3.5 billion
One of the richest royals in the world is also the richest European monarch and one of the wealthiest heads of state in the world.
The Prince of Liechtenstein has board powers, almost exclusive ruling power.
Legally he is still the Head of the State, but since 2004 he has allowed his son to do most of the day-to-day governmental decisions as a way of beginning a dynastic transition to a new generation.
